I have a 2010 Insight. The auto-stop is a joke. Half the time it does not even shut off the engine at a stop light. However, when it does shut off the engine at a stop sign, it only does it for about 30 seconds. Then the engine restarts. Is this normal? Do I have to bring it into the dealership to have something reset? Any comments out there???

Replying to: rookie60 (Feb 04, 2010 10:58 am) The owners manuals lists a number of reasons the auto-stop does not engage. Some of them are listed above. I found the engine restarts 18 seconds after stopping. After a lot of testing, I found if the ventilation system is on, the car restarted in 18 seconds. Like clock work. But, if you press the off button and shut off the ventilation system (the screen goes blank) the engine stays off until you let up on the brake. |
